Industry (including construction), value added in Monaco
Monaco: Industry (including construction), value added was 1.32 billion current LCU in 2024. ▲ Rising
Industry (including construction), value added in Monaco, 2010–2024
Source: Country official statistics, National Statistical Offices (NSOs). Measured in current LCU.
Analysis
In 2024, industry (including construction), value added in Monaco stood at 1.32 billion current LCU. That is the highest value across all 15 years on record.
The figure is up 23.6% on the previous year and up 95.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, industry (including construction), value added in Monaco peaked at 1.32 billion current LCU in 2024 and was at its lowest, 523.20 million current LCU, in 2010.
Monaco ranks 179th of 208 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 15 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 747.79 million current LCU | 523.20 million current LCU | 1.07 billion current LCU | 10 |
| 2020s | 1.04 billion current LCU | 877.80 million current LCU | 1.32 billion current LCU | 5 |

About this data
Industry (including construction) corresponds to ISIC (Rev.4) divisions 05-43. It is comprised of mining, manufacturing, construction, electricity, water, and gas industries. Value added is the contribution to the economy by a producer or an industry or an institutional sector, which is estimated by the total value of output produced and deducting the total value of intermediate consumption of goods and services used to produce that output.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This series is expressed in local currency units.
